THIS IS A REPLICA OF A LIBRARY CHAIR BENJAMIN FRANKLIN EITHER INVENTED OR IMPORTED FROM ENGLAND IN THE LATE 1700s

If you like to work with wood, you may want to build one of these unique and very practical Library Chair -Step Stools in your spare time in your own shop.

1. PLANS: Detailed plans and drawings. Including FULL SIZE PATTERNS  Everything you need. Measurements, a variety of clear easy to understand views. Instructions.

2. TEMPLATES: Full size paper templates. All you have to do is trace the various parts on any wood of your choice. Cut the pieces. Sand smooth. Varnish or paint and assemble the chair at your own speed. Assembly instructions included with Templates.

3. HARDWARE KIT: Available (optional) at extra charge. Contains: All of the screws (16) plus one pair of top quality brass hinges.
